Departmentalizing/Co-Teaching
We are excited to use a team approach this year. Ms. Wade will teach a Math, Science, and Social Studies. Ms. Heitmeier will teach Reading and Language Arts. Your child will rotate with his/her homeroom. It is our hope that we can do more integrated projects within our content areas while utilizing our particular talents as teachers to benefit all of our students.
This year your child’s homeroom is also a co-taught classroom. This means that your child will have two teachers that will share the responsibilities of teaching all subjects. Mrs. DeCouto will co-teach with Ms. Wade and Ms. Heitmeier. With two teachers, the class will have a smaller student to teacher ratio. Also, your child will have more individualized instructional time in whole and small groups. Our class is composed of students of all learning levels. We are excited to be working together as co-teachers, and we are pleased to share in this experience with your child.
A good learning experience is built on a cooperative effort between parent, child, and teachers. Our expectations for conduct and standards for academic growth are high. With your participation in and out of the classroom we can look forward to a productive, creative, and fun year together. We are excited about this year and we hope we can work together to make it one of growth, discovery, and significance for your child.
